Abstract

The utility model relates to coffee bean milling device of coffee making machine technical fields, refer in particular to a kind of bean milling machine of spherical surface emery wheel, including for cooperating the interior emery wheel and outer emery wheel of mill beans, the meal outlet into beans mouth is respectively equipped with above and below cooperation spacing between the interior emery wheel and outer emery wheel, the end face of the interior emery wheel is bulb shape, the inner ring of the outer emery wheel is the dome shape of recess, and the interior emery wheel and outer emery wheel pass through spherical mating surface and realize bean-grinding function;The meal outlet is located at the lower end of the outer emery wheel in the radial direction.The bean milling machine of the spherical surface emery wheel of the utility model has contact area big, is milled high-efficient, while can also vertically descend beans and vertical powder falling, ground coffee is avoided to remain by the contact grinding registration interface designs of outer emery wheel and interior emery wheel at dome shape.

Detailed description of the invention
Fig. 1 is the structural schematic diagram of the utility model;
Fig. 2 is the inner surface schematic diagram of the outer emery wheel of the utility model;
Fig. 3 is the outer surface schematic diagram of the interior emery wheel of the utility model.
In figure: 1, interior emery wheel;2, outer emery wheel;3, into beans mouth;4, meal outlet;5, interior skewed slot;6, outer skewed slot;7, cambered surface is convex Muscle;8, spherical surface convex ribs;9, fuselage;10, beans case;11, driving device;12, installation position;13, beans chamber is stored up.
Specific embodiment
The technical solution of the utility model is illustrated with embodiment with reference to the accompanying drawing.
As shown in Figure 1, a kind of bean milling machine of spherical surface emery wheel described in the utility model, including for cooperating the interior mill of mill beans 1 and outer emery wheel 2 are taken turns, is respectively equipped with above and below the cooperation spacing between the interior emery wheel 1 and outer emery wheel 2 into beans mouth 3 Meal outlet 4, the end face of the interior emery wheel 1 are bulb shape, and the inner ring of the outer emery wheel 2 is the dome shape of recess, the interior emery wheel 1 Pass through spherical mating surface with outer emery wheel 2 and realizes bean-grinding function;The meal outlet 4 is located at the lower end radial direction side of the outer emery wheel 2 Upwards.The contact of outer emery wheel 2 and interior emery wheel 1 is ground registration interface designs balling-up by the bean milling machine of the spherical surface emery wheel of the utility model Planar, during interior emery wheel 1 and outer emery wheel 2 relatively rotate, coffee bean is entered between emery wheel from top into beans mouth 3 After fit clearance, due to being the coordinate contact surface of dome shape between emery wheel, so that the contact area between emery wheel is bigger, Ke Yitong When the coffee bean of one complete cycle circle is ground, be milled it is more efficient;Coffee bean enters above spherical emery wheel fit structure, It is fallen downwards along the surface of spherical surface during the grinding process, finally most holds meal outlet 4 in the radial direction to fall under outer emery wheel 2 It falls, may be implemented vertically to descend beans and again into powder falling, effectively avoids ground coffee residue problem, emery wheel is avoided to be frequently necessary to the fiber crops of cleaning It is tired.
As shown in Figures 2 and 3, the inner surface of the outer emery wheel 2 is equipped with a plurality of interior skewed slot 5, the outer surface of the interior emery wheel 1 Equipped with multiple outer skewed slots 6, the interior skewed slot 5 is opposite with the inclined direction of the outer skewed slot 6.Pass through interior skewed slot 5 and outer skewed slot 6 Cooperation, so that coffee bean is easier to enter the fit clearance between emery wheel, charging more rapidly, can effectively improve milling efficiency.
As shown in Figures 2 and 3, the inner surface bottom end of the outer emery wheel 2 is equipped with a plurality of spiral cambered surface convex ribs 7, described interior The head end of emery wheel 1 is equipped with a plurality of spiral spherical surface convex ribs 8, the hand of spiral phase of the cambered surface convex ribs 7 and the spherical surface convex ribs 8 Instead.Cooperated by spiral cambered surface convex ribs 7 and spherical surface convex ribs 8, realizes grinding function, coffee bean express delivery can be pulverized, be mentioned High grinding efficiency.Further, the fit clearance between the cambered surface convex ribs 7 and spherical surface convex ribs 8 gradually becomes smaller from top to bottom, this Sample can so that coffee bean in moving process from top to bottom, is fully ground into powder, and then be easier from below go out powder Mouth 4 is fallen.
As shown in Figure 1, further including fuselage 9 and beans case 10, the beans case 10 is installed on 9 top of fuselage;The outer mill Wheel 2 is fixed in the fuselage 9, and the interior emery wheel 1 is fixed in driving device 11, and the driving device 11 is fixedly installed in institute It states in beans case 10.Interior emery wheel 1 is installed in beans case 10, space can be effectively saved, keeps the volume of bean milling machine more small and exquisite.It is described The medium position of beans case 10 is equipped with installation position 12, and the driving device 11 is installed in installation position 12;The outside of the beans case 10 To store up beans chamber 13, the storage beans chamber 13 is arranged around the installation position 12, and the bottom end of the beans case 10 is towards described into beans Mouth 3.Such structure design, can both be such that the coffee bean stored up in beans chamber 13 quickly falls into the fit clearance of emery wheel, but also The fitment stability between emery wheel can be improved.
The bean milling machine of the spherical surface emery wheel of the utility model, when needing to carry out coffee bean grinding, by the lid of 10 top of beans case Son is opened, and coffee bean is encased in the storage beans chamber 13 inside beans case 10, closes the lid, then starts machine, making can be automatic Start to be milled.After machine is powered, driving device 11 will start to work, such as variable speed electric motors, particularly, start turning, interior emery wheel 1 and drive Dynamic device 11 is sequentially connected, therefore interior emery wheel 1 just starts high speed rotation, since outer emery wheel 2 is fixed from rotation with fuselage 9, this Emery wheel 1 will produce relative rotation with outer emery wheel 2 in sample.During emery wheel relatively rotates, the coffee bean in beans chamber 13 is stored up Will above the fit clearance between emery wheel, that is, into continuously entering in the gap between emery wheel at beans mouth 3, Under the grinding of emery wheel, coffee bean is gradually pulverized.Specifically, coffee bean can enter mill out of interior skewed slot 5 and outer skewed slot 6 It between wheel, and can be moved from the top down along the spherical surface of emery wheel, in this moving process, coffee bean is in 7 He of cambered surface convex ribs Under the grinding of spherical surface convex ribs 8, it is rolled into fritter before this, is then ground into coarse powder, be eventually ground to fine powder, then from out Powder mouth 4, which is fallen in the powder box of bottom, to be collected.
